Other cities (and their schools) you should consider:
Chicago (Northwestern)
DC (Georgetown)
Philadelphia (Penn)
You missed the ED deadlines for all of them, but RD is at least worth a shot. 4 years WE and strong PS/LORs could make up for a low GPA at one of them.
UC schools are picky about GPA, so you're probably not getting into UCLA. BC and BU are definitely possibilites, and will likely offer at least some $, for that LSAT score.
